Spaghetti aglio e olio with sautéed mushrooms
Spaghetti aglio e olio is a classic Italian dish that showcases the simplicity and beauty of vegetarian pasta recipes. This recipe combines the bold flavors of garlic and olive oil with the earthy richness of sautéed mushrooms.
To make this dish, start by cooking your spaghetti according to package instructions until al dente. While the pasta is cooking, he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té until fragrant and golden brown.
Next, add sliced mushrooms to the pan and cook until they are tender and lightly browned. Season with salt, pepper, and a pinch of red pepper flakes for some added heat.
Once the spaghetti is cooked, drain it well and add it to the pan with the mushrooms. Toss everything together until the pasta is well coated in the garlic-infused olive oil.
Serve this delectable dish with a sprinkle of freshly grated Parmesan cheese and a handful of chopped parsley for a burst of freshness. The combination of flavors in this spaghetti aglio e olio with sautéed mushrooms will surely elevate your pasta game to new heights!
Lemon and herb linguine with grilled asparagus
One of the most refreshing and vibrant vegetarian pasta recipes is the lemon and herb linguine with grilled asparagus. This dish combines the delicate flavors of lemon, herbs, and perfectly grilled asparagus to create a light and satisfying meal.
To make this masterpiece, start by cooking linguine according to package instructions until al dente. While the pasta cooks, prepare the grilled asparagus by tossing it in olive oil, salt, and pepper. Grill the asparagus until tender and slightly charred.
In a separate pan, melt butter over medium heat and add minced garlic. Sauté for a minute until fragrant. Then, add freshly squeezed lemon juice and zest to the pan along with chopped fresh herbs like parsley, basil, or thyme. Stir everything together to infuse the flavors.
Once the linguine is cooked, drain it and add it directly to the pan with the lemon herb sauce. Toss everything together until well coated. Finally, add the grilled asparagus on top of the linguine or mix it in for an even distribution.
The combination of tangy lemon, aromatic herbs, and smoky grilled asparagus creates a burst of flavors in every bite. The vibrant green color of the asparagus adds a beautiful touch to this dish, making it visually appealing as well.
This lemon and herb linguine with grilled asparagus is perfect for those who crave a light yet satisfying pasta dish. It's an excellent option for spring or summer when fresh asparagus is abundant. Serve it as a main course or alongside a salad for a complete meal that will impress your guests.

One-pot vegetable primavera pasta
One-pot vegetable primavera pasta is a delightful dish that brings together the freshness of seasonal vegetables with the comfort of pasta. This recipe is not only delicious but also incredibly easy to make, as everything cooks in one pot, saving you time and effort.
To start, gather an assortment of colorful vegetables such as bell peppers, zucchini, cherry tomatoes, and broccoli. Chop them into bite-sized pieces and set aside. In a large pot, heat some olive oil over medium heat and add minced garlic. Sauté for a minute until fragrant.
Next, add the chopped vegetables to the pot and sauté for a few minutes until they start to soften. Season with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ning to enhance the flavors. Then pour in vegetable broth or water and bring it to a boil.
Once the liquid is boiling, add your favorite pasta shape to the pot. You can use penne, fusilli, or any other type you prefer. Cook according to package instructions until al dente,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king.
As the pasta cooks, it will absorb all the flavors from the vegetables and broth. The result is a wonderfully flavorful dish that showcases the vibrant colors of springtime produce.
When the pasta is cooked to perfection, remove it from heat and stir in some grated Parmesan cheese for added richness. The cheese will melt into the sauce and give it a creamy texture without any heavy cream.
Garnish your one-pot vegetable primavera pasta with fresh basil leaves or parsley for a pop of freshness. Serve it hot and savor each bite as you enjoy the medley of flavors from the tender vegetables and perfectly cooked pasta.

Roasted red pepper and feta pasta
Roasted red pepper and feta pasta is a delightful combination of flavors that will leave your taste buds craving for more. The sweetness of the roasted red peppers perfectly complements the tanginess of the feta cheese, creating a harmonious balance in every bite.
To make this dish, start by roasting red bell peppers until they are charred and tender. Once cooled, remove the skin and seeds, and slice them into thin strips. In a pan, sauté some garlic in olive oil until fragrant, then add the roasted red peppers and cook for a few minutes to enhance their flavor.
Next, cook your favorite p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ain the pasta, reserving some of the cooking water. Add the cooked pasta to the pan with the roasted red peppers and toss everything together gently.
Crumble some feta cheese over the pasta and give it a good stir to allow the cheese to melt slightly. If desired, you can also sprinkle some fresh herbs like basil or parsley for added freshness.
The result is a vibrant and satisfying vegetarian pasta dish that is bursting with flavor. The creamy feta cheese adds richness while the roasted red peppers provide a smoky depth that elevates this dish to new heights.

Creamy avocado and spinach pasta
Creamy avocado and spinach pasta is a delightful combination of flavors and textures. The creamy avocado adds richness to the dish, while the spinach brings a fresh and vibrant taste. This recipe is not only delicious but also packed with nutrients. Avocado is known for its healthy fats, and spinach is loaded with vitamins and minerals. To make this pasta, simply blend ripe avocados with garlic, lemon juice, and olive oil until smooth. Cook your favorite pasta according to package instructions and toss it with the creamy avocado sauce. Add sautéed spinach for an extra boost of green goodness. This dish is perfect for those who want a quick and satisfying vegetarian meal that doesn't compromise on taste or nutrition.
